First step is cleanser!

I've been loving the Neutrogena "Hydro Boost Clenser"


Super hydrating and contains hyaluronic acid that may sound scary, but it actually helped my skin.

I use this day and night. In the morning to start fresh and remove all the impurities and at night I actually use it to remove my make up; and lemme tell you.. that baby works!

Second step is toner.

I've been using La Cura "Healthy Glow" toner.


Need to admit I got it because it looked like the Pixi "Glow" tonic but for the fraction of the price but to be fair is working beautifully. It lightly exfoliate the skin living it glowy and fresh.

After having a good conversation with my sister about my skin type (for those who don't know my skin is very dry) she told me that using oil, as I was doing everyday, wasn't actually a clever idea and that I should use instead moisturiser to put back the moisture into my skin.

Who would've thought!

So I've been using the E.l.f daily hydration moisturiser day and night and have to say that little genius of my sis was right. My skin never felt so good!!


Now let's jump into make up.

Since the colder months I ditched the foundation. I got frustrated one day and I thought that: anyway foundation never go along with my skin and I spend half of the time blowing my nose due to catching a cold every other day so the foundation gets removed I look like a snotty mess (gross I know).

Overall my skin is doing better since changing the skincare routine that I actually don't need foundation to cover much except for my under eye bags.

So I go straight in with concealer.

After everyone and their mum was talking about the "new" Make up Revolution "Conceal and Define" concealer I went my self and bought it and I understand why everyone loves it.

It does a pretty good job at covering my under eye bags.

I apply it under my eyes, around my nose blend it with a beauty blender and job done.

On a lazy day after this step I will go with mascara and leave the house, but for blog post purpose I will tell you all the steps.


After applying concealer I go ahead and bash my face with bronzer, I use a rather new purchase from Wycon, it's part of their new summer collection and I bloody love it.


It has just that perfect warm tone for me that makes me look sun kissed without looking orange!

Than I go on with some blush, a step that I never really did, but I got this tiny Benefit "Gold Rush" as a part of a Christmas present and after realising the hard way that it was a blush and not an highlighter, I've been using it no stop. It is rose gold with a bit of shimmer and makes my skin looking a bit more healthy.


Than I will do my eyebrows, yet another step that I used to skip, but I don't know why lately I've been obsessed with the bushy eye brow look and had the urge to do it.

I didn't want a pencil or a pomade, because:

A: I am not patient enough to apply it

B: I wanted a more messy look

So I got a gel tint from Wycon and it's been very fun to use.

The product has a dark tint and a tiny brush so I just brush my eyebrow upwards so it only takes me few seconds to achieve that bushy look I had in mind.


I was on the hunt for a cheap but good palette than had mostly warm tones, but some cool colour as well for when I was feeling a bit more wild (which is hardly ever) so I got the Make up Revolution Soph palette.

I usually use only a warm brawn all over my eye lid, in the days I feel more adventurous (which is hardly ever) I use the orange and red tones. Bloody love it.


Than will go with a duo that I've been using for the longest time.

The Revlon "Photo ready Insta-fix" and the Collection "Gorgeous glow" highlighter.

I know I double my highlighter, but a girl's gotta do what a girl's gotta do.


I use the Revlon one first, on the high point of my cheeks and my favourite part, the tip of my nose.

Your girl is gotta light up the town.

Than I go over that with a fan brush and the Collection highlighter.


Now for a step that I hardly miss is mascara, a fair new one is "The mascara Revolution" from Make up Revolution, bit clumpy and I realised that throughout the day it leaves some fall out but it makes the eyelashes full and super long.
